About

Xuewen Yin is a scholar working on Electrical and Electronic Engineering, Materials Chemistry and Polymers and Plastics. According to data from OpenAlex, Xuewen Yin has authored 59 papers receiving a total of 1.8k indexed citations (citations by other indexed papers that have themselves been cited), including 35 papers in Electrical and Electronic Engineering, 21 papers in Materials Chemistry and 17 papers in Polymers and Plastics. Recurrent topics in Xuewen Yin’s work include Perovskite Materials and Applications (29 papers), Quantum Dots Synthesis And Properties (18 papers) and Conducting polymers and applications (17 papers). Xuewen Yin is often cited by papers focused on Perovskite Materials and Applications (29 papers), Quantum Dots Synthesis And Properties (18 papers) and Conducting polymers and applications (17 papers). Xuewen Yin collaborates with scholars based in China, Australia and Canada. Xuewen Yin's co-authors include Hong Lin, Yu Zhou, Jianhua Han, Junfeng Zhang, Jianbao Li, Meiqian Tai, Zhibo Yao, Hui Nan, Ning Wang and Yangying Zhou and has published in prestigious journals such as Journal of Computational Physics, Chemical Engineering Journal and ACS Applied Materials & Interfaces.
